What companies run services between Colmar, France and Lisbon, Portugal?

You can take a train from Colmar to Lisboa Oriente via Lyon Part Dieu, Barcelona-Sants, Madrid-Puerta de Atocha-Almudena Grandes, Badajoz, and Entroncamento in around 23h 36m.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Colmar to Lisbon - Oriente via Zürich in around 35h 30m.
